package spectrum
import (
"fmt"
"io/ioutil"
"os"
"path"
"path/filepath"
"github.com/apache/camel-k/pkg/builder"
"github.com/apache/camel-k/pkg/platform"
"github.com/apache/camel-k/pkg/util/log"
spectrum "github.com/container-tools/spectrum/pkg/builder"
metav1 "k8s.io/apimachinery/pkg/apis/meta/v1"
)
func publisher(ctx *builder.Context) error {
libraryPath := path.Join(ctx.Path, "context", "dependencies")
_, err := os.Stat(libraryPath)
if err != nil && os.IsNotExist(err) {
// this can only indicate that there are no more libraries to add to the base image,
// because transitive resolution is the same even if spec differs
log.Infof("No new image to build, reusing existing image %s", ctx.BaseImage)
ctx.Image = ctx.BaseImage
return nil
} else if err != nil {
return err
}
pl, err := platform.GetCurrentPlatform(ctx.C, ctx, ctx.Namespace)
if err != nil {
return err
}
target := "camel-k-" + ctx.Build.Meta.Name + ":" + ctx.Build.Meta.ResourceVersion
repo := pl.Status.Build.Registry.Organization
if repo != "" {
target = fmt.Sprintf("%s/%s", repo, target)
} else {
target = fmt.Sprintf("%s/%s", ctx.Namespace, target)
}
registry := pl.Status.Build.Registry.Address
if registry != "" {
target = fmt.Sprintf("%s/%s", registry, target)
}
pullInsecure := pl.Status.Build.Registry.Insecure // incremental build case
if ctx.BaseImage == pl.Status.Build.BaseImage {
// Assuming the base image is always secure (we should add a flag)
pullInsecure = false
}
registryConfigDir := ""
if pl.Spec.Build.Registry.Secret != "" {
registryConfigDir, err = mountSecret(ctx, pl.Spec.Build.Registry.Secret)
if err != nil {
return err
}
defer os.RemoveAll(registryConfigDir)
}
options := spectrum.Options{
PullInsecure: pullInsecure,
PushInsecure: pl.Status.Build.Registry.Insecure,
PullConfigDir: registryConfigDir,
PushConfigDir: registryConfigDir,
Base: ctx.BaseImage,
Target: target,
Stdout: os.Stdout,
Stderr: os.Stderr,
}
digest, err := spectrum.Build(options, libraryPath+":/deployments/dependencies")
if err != nil {
return err
}
ctx.Image = target
ctx.Digest = digest
return nil
}
func mountSecret(ctx *builder.Context, name string) (string, error) {
dir, err := ioutil.TempDir("", "spectrum-secret-")
if err != nil {
return "", err
}
secret, err := ctx.CoreV1().Secrets(ctx.Namespace).Get(ctx.C, name, metav1.GetOptions{})
if err != nil {
os.RemoveAll(dir)
return "", err
}
for file, content := range secret.Data {
if err := ioutil.WriteFile(filepath.Join(dir, remap(file)), content, 0600); err != nil {
os.RemoveAll(dir)
return "", err
}
}
return dir, nil
}
func remap(name string) string {
if name == ".dockerconfigjson" {
return "config.json"
}
return name
}
